Honeit and PowerDialer.ai are both AI meeting assistants for recording, transcription, and summaries, compared here on pricing, features, and workflow fit. Honeit: Interview intelligence platform for recruiting and RPO teams with built-in calling, AI transcription, and shareable interview soundbites. PowerDialer.ai: AI-powered parallel and power dialer for outbound sales teams that auto-records, transcribes, and analyzes calls and surfaces AI coaching suggestions. Pros & cons
Honeit
+ Combines calling, transcription, and candidate presentation in one tool
+ Soundbites let hiring managers hear candidates directly
- Geared toward recruiting and RPO rather than general meetings
PowerDialer.ai
+ Combines high-volume dialing with built-in recording, transcription, and AI analysis
+ Flat-rate pricing model avoids per-user penalties for growing teams
- Focused on outbound phone calls rather than video-meeting conversation intelligence
